The show had performances from the likes of Selena Gomez, Lizzo, Taylor Swift, Kesha, Post Malone, Halsey, Billie Eilish, Camila Cabello and Shawn Mendes. They even included some legends like Ozzy Osbourne, Green Day, Christina Aguilera and Shania Twain.

Selena Gomez’s First Performance In Over 2 Years

The show opened up on an emotional note: Selena Gomez looking divine in a long black gown. We watched in silence as she sang her heart out to her new single “Lose You To Love Me.” She later changed the tempo to her more upbeat hit, “Look At Her Now,” to match her new shiny leotard outfit change. Artist of the Decade Award

As some of you may know, a lot of drama surrounded Taylor Swift’s right to perform her own songs at the AMAs this year. However, she persevered and showed up ready to play! Taylor Swift has been a role model for so many of her fans and has created a safe place for artists in the music industry, so it doesn’t come as much of a surprise that she was awarded the Artist of the Decade Award.
